Posting on Instagram, Zac Shuaib confirmed he’s officially signed professional terms with Real Sociedad, joining the club following his summer departure from Arsenal.
“Honoured to sign my first pro contract with Real Sociedad,” Shuaib wrote. “Let’s get to work. Aupa Real.”

Shuaib had been on a scholarship contract with Arsenal for the last couple of seasons, but the Gunners opted not to offer him a professional deal. As a result, he was included on their list of departing players published in June.
The player had already spent time with Brighton on a trial basis before that, and he also held a trial with Real Sociedad before his eventual transfer.
As an under-23 player, Arsenal were technically due compensation for their time training the youngster in their academy, but Alex Howell reported for the BBC that sources say they waived that compensation.

Shuaib had a personal connection with Real Sociedad, as his mother’s family are Basque. The player’s grandparents reportedly dreamed he’d end up playing for Sociedad, the club they support.
Shuaib made four appearances for the Arsenal u18s in his final campaign for the club, having made six in 2023/24. The player’s limited minutes meant a summer departure was always likely, but a move to Real Sociedad is a strong one that should ensure he lands on his feet.
